Summary
When Elias inherits his uncle’s orchard, he expects a quiet stretch of land and a chance to start over. What he finds instead is a crooked tree that never stops blooming and whispers that call his name at night. As he unravels his uncle’s journals, Elias learns of a role passed down through generations, the keeper of the orchard, bound to guard its secrets and feed its hunger. With each step closer to the truth, Elias discovers the orchard doesn’t just remember the past, it wants a voice for the future.
